In short: Great day out round Oxford, well marshalled plenty of water shame about bag storage In full: A great day out, shuttle buses from mini plant car park to start were very good, not so obvious to find on the way back though. Great venue for an HQ and finish.
Ran a PB taking 5 minutes of my previous, there were a couple of tight spots on the Thames path but nothing to serious.
The only gripe was bag storage, long queue to put my bag in and then an even longer queue (45min to an hour) to get it back which after a half when you are getting cold is not a good place to be!!
Get that sorted and it would make all the difference. Date of review: October 14, 2012

In short: Pros:Massive improvement on last year. Cons: 1 hour wait at the baggage queue after the race. In full: I ran this last year and there is a massive improvement:) The route has changed and it's great running along the Thames and seeing the rowers on the river. Parking was very organised this time round. Bands along the route - great touch. Road closures - fantastic - there were none last year. New start line. Good signage. Goody bag, medal and T-shirt very good. To work on: 1. It's a good idea to have the time car at the start before the runners get there. 2. Speakers at the start were poor- couldn't hear anything from the start, except the horn. 3. More marshals on the first water stop (I had to get water from the boxes of bottle. 4. Baggage pick up was bad. I waited for an hour. Fortunately it wasn't raining and everyone was in good spirits. The orangisors should look at Reading - 12,000 runners and I pick my bag up in just a few minutes. Date of review: October 14, 2012

In full: Very enjoyable race which I will do again as it is very local to me. Having spoken to people who did it last year the organisation at this years race is much better. Good support from the crowds and a nice touch to finish in the Kassam Stadium. My only gripe is the baggage collection area at the end. It was far too small and too slow which meant lots of waiting around as the queue seemed to take forever to move. It was a good job that the weather was sunny!!!. Having said that a recommended race.
